Beirut Pharmacy and Medical Centre had filed a total of 1,706 claims with discrepancies leading to a loss of Sh15 million. [File, Standard]

The National Health Insurance Fund (NHIF) has a week to release the names of officers involved in fraudulent payments to Beirut Pharmacy and Medical Centre in Eastleigh, Nairobi.

Parliamentary Health Committee chairperson Robert Pukose gave the ultimatum on Thursday, February 16, during a session with relevant health stakeholders to address corruption concerns at NHIF.
